在Python编程中,我们经常会遇到“可选任意字符”的问题,例如在正则表达式的应用中。这个问题对于很多开发者来说可能有些棘手,但理解其背后的逻辑和实现方法,就能轻松应对。
### 问题背景
在某个项目中,我们的开发团队需要实现一个用户输入的表单验证,要求能够匹配用户输入的任意字符组合。例如,我们希望用户可以在输入框中输入字母、数字或符号,而我们需要确保如果输入为空也能够正常处理。此时,涉及到“
Python是一种在数据处理上非常占优势的计算机编程语言,这一篇文章就记录我在学习正则表达式时的经验吧。此处只介绍常用的正则表达式,学完后一般的正则表达式也都能处理啦。一、入门常用正则表达式符号: ^a //以a开头 . //任意一个字符 * //任意数量的字符 * //任意字符任意数量 3$ // 以3结尾 ? //消除贪婪模式举个栗子:line="booooooobby123"假如想
转载
2023-11-07 11:10:53
78阅读
查看官方文档手册:链接:https://www.tslang.cn/docs/home.html (一)Boolean
最基本的数据类型就是简单的true/false值
The most basic datatype is the simple true/false value, which JavaScript and TypeScript call a boolean value.
ex
转载
2024-09-14 22:16:16
29阅读
# Python实现任意字符
作为一名经验丰富的开发者,我将教会你如何在Python中实现"任意字符"。下面是实现这个功能的详细步骤。
## 步骤概述
为了更好地理解整个过程,我将使用表格展示实现"任意字符"的步骤。每个步骤将有相应的代码和注释,以帮助你理解每一行代码的作用。
| 步骤 | 描述 | 代码示例
原创
2023-09-02 05:18:06
81阅读
# TypeScript 定义对象任意可选属性指南
在 TypeScript 中,定义对象的任意可选属性是一项常见的需求。这种灵活性使得我们在开发中可以轻松地处理多种情况。本文将引导你理解如何在 TypeScript 中实现这一点,并为你提供详细的步骤和代码示例。本文最后还会呈现一个甘特图,以帮助你更好地理解整个过程。
## 流程概述
在这里,我们将通过以下几个步骤来定义对象的任意可选属性:
python键盘输入字符两种方法 第一种方法:import os
import sys,tty,termios
fd=sys.stdin.fileno()
old_settings=termios.tcgetattr(fd)
try:
tty.setraw(fd)
ch=sys.stdin.read(1)
finally:
termios.tcsetattr(fd, termi
转载
2023-06-05 15:03:11
289阅读
一、输入与输出#输入与输出
str = input("请输入任意字符:")
print(type(str)) #input获取的数据类型皆为字符串
print(str)
#运行结果:
请输入任意字符:abc
<class 'str'>
abc#格式化输出
name = "liu"
age = 18
print("My name is %s, and I'm %d yea
转载
2023-08-01 20:08:54
230阅读
五、String字符串1.什么是字符串字符串是以单引号或者双引号括起来的任意文本,一个字符串由若干个任意字符组成2.创建字符串str1 = "hello world"
str2 = 'you are good'3.字符串运算3.1字符串链接 3.1.1 使用加号进行链接#字符串的链接,通过“+”进行链接
s1 = 'welcome'
s2 = 'to guangzhou'
print(s1 + s
转载
2023-08-04 10:52:21
56阅读
# Python 正则之任意字符
在编程中,我们经常需要对字符串进行匹配、查找或替换操作。Python提供了re模块,可以使用正则表达式来实现这些功能。正则表达式是一种用来匹配字符串的强大工具,它可以在文本中按照某种模式搜索和匹配特定的内容。
正则表达式中的任意字符是一种特殊的正则表达式,用来表示任意的字符。在正则表达式中,我们可以使用`.`来表示任意字符。
下面我们来通过一些例子来了解如何
原创
2023-12-17 06:00:10
127阅读
# Python匹配任意字符的实现
## 1. 整体流程
下面是实现Python匹配任意字符的整体流程图:
```mermaid
flowchart TD
A(开始) --> B(导入re模块)
B --> C(定义正则表达式)
C --> D(使用re.match进行匹配)
D --> E(判断匹配结果)
E -- 匹配成功 --> F(输出匹配成功
原创
2023-10-20 07:09:29
98阅读
## Python 任意字符替换
在Python编程语言中,我们经常会遇到需要替换字符串中的某些字符或者子串的情况。Python提供了一些简单而强大的方法来实现这个目标,使得字符串替换操作变得轻松简单。
### replace()方法
Python中的字符串对象拥有内置的`replace()`方法,它可以用于替换字符串中的字符或者子串。它的语法如下:
```python
str.repla
原创
2023-08-20 07:33:01
212阅读
# Python 字符串的任意字符
在 Python 中,字符串是一个非常重要且常用的数据类型。字符串是由字符组成的序列,允许我们进行多种操作,如拼接、查找、切片等。有时我们需要在字符串中处理任意字符,本文将介绍如何在 Python 中实现这一功能以及相关的代码示例。
## 字符串的基本操作
Python 的字符串操作非常灵活,最基本的操作包括创建、访问和修改字符串。通过下例,我们可以看到如
# Python 正则匹配任意字符
## 引言
Python 正则表达式是一种强大的字符串处理工具,可以用来匹配、查找和替换字符串中的特定模式。正则表达式由一系列字符和操作符组成,用于定义匹配模式。
在本文中,我们将教会一位刚入行的开发者如何使用 Python 正则表达式来实现匹配任意字符的功能。
## 目标
我们的目标是教会这位开发者如何使用 Python 正则表达式来匹配任意字符。
#
原创
2023-09-30 12:14:00
134阅读
在使用 Python 进行输入操作时,可能会遇到一个有趣的问题:如何实现用户输入任意字符退出程序。这种情况在处理用户输入时是非常常见的,尤其是在编写命令行工具或需要交互的应用时。本文将详细介绍如何实现这一功能,同时提供排错指南,生态扩展等内容,帮助你更好地理解这个问题的解决方案。
## 环境准备
为了让我们的代码能够顺利运行,确保你的开发环境里安装好 Python。以下是依赖安装的说明,适用于
# Python正则匹配任意字符的实现
## 1. 介绍
在Python中,正则表达式是一种强大的工具,用于在字符串中搜索、替换和匹配文本。正则表达式可以用来匹配特定的字符模式,包括任意字符。本文将指导你如何使用Python正则表达式匹配任意字符。
## 2. 步骤概览
下面是整个流程的步骤概览,你可以使用表格来展示:
| 步骤 | 描述 |
| ---- | ---- |
| 步骤1
原创
2023-08-27 12:40:29
489阅读
# Python:使用任意字符退出程序
在编程过程中,我们经常需要编写一些程序来与用户交互。有时,用户可能希望在输入任意字符后能够退出程序。Python作为一门易学易用的编程语言,各种交互实现非常方便。本文将为大家详细讲解如何在Python中实现“输入任意字符退出”的功能,并附上代码示例以便大家参考。
## 什么是输入?
输入是指程序与用户间的互动过程。用户通过键盘输入信息,程序接收并处理这
原创
2024-10-25 04:40:34
126阅读
# 学习如何在Python中处理任意空白字符
## 引言
在Python编程中,白空字符(如空格、制表符等)是非常常见且重要的元素。处理这些字符的方法有很多种,今天我们将深入探讨如何在Python中使用正则表达式来匹配和处理任意空白字符。
## 文章结构
我们将根据以下步骤来完成我们的学习任务:
| 步骤 | 描述 |
|------|-----
# Python匹配任意特殊字符教程
作为一名经验丰富的开发者,我很高兴能帮助刚入行的小白们学习如何使用Python来匹配任意特殊字符。在这篇文章中,我将详细介绍整个过程,包括必要的步骤、代码示例以及解释。
## 流程图
首先,让我们通过一个流程图来了解整个过程:
```mermaid
flowchart TD
A[开始] --> B{是否需要匹配特殊字符?}
B -->|
原创
2024-07-19 13:45:48
27阅读
# 项目方案:通过Python实现一个接受任意字符的输入程序
## 项目概述
本项目旨在通过Python编程语言实现一个程序,能够接受用户输入的任意字符,包括字母、数字、符号等,然后将用户输入的字符进行处理并输出。通过本项目,用户可以了解如何在Python中处理任意字符输入,并学习基本的字符处理技巧。
## 技术实现
为了实现这个项目,我们将使用Python中的input()函数来接受用户的输
原创
2024-04-03 06:33:37
35阅读
# Python中代表任意字符
在Python中,我们经常会使用一些特殊的符号来代表一定范围内的任意字符,这在字符串处理和正则表达式中特别常见。其中,代表任意字符的符号是`.`,下面我们就来详细介绍一下这个特殊符号在Python中的用法和示例。
## 1. 代表任意字符
在Python的正则表达式中,`.`表示匹配除换行符以外的任意字符。换句话说,`.`可以匹配任何单个字符,无论是字母、数字
原创
2024-07-11 05:59:49
199阅读